Children in Pre+K through Grade 8 follow the Pflaum Gospel Weeklies program, which is a traditional faith formation program committed to sharing the richness of our faith and building family values. Each session includes stories, activities, scripture, prayer, discussion and reflection. www.pflaumweeklies.com

The sacraments of Reconciliation and Eucharist ("First Communion") are typically celebrated in the 2nd grade. Sacramental preparation begins in the 1st grade and enrollment in Faith Formation is required during both years of this two-year preparation period. Attending workshops is also required.
The sacrament of Confirmation is typically celebrated in the 8th grade. Sacramental preparation begins with enrollment in the 7th grade Faith Formation, and this is a two-year preparation period. Other requirements include attending workshops, service projects, and the mandatory retreat.
(Older individuals can also prepare for these Sacraments of Initiation, via the R.C.I.A.) Please don't hesitate to ask us any questions, about your particular situation. We encourage everyone to become fully formed and participating Catholics!
